This elegant Jewish funeral tribute features a classic Star of David shape, created with fresh white and royal blue chrysanthemums for a serene, dignified expression of sympathy.

Perfect for funerals, memorials or shiva, this tribute symbolises faith, respect and everlasting love. Our skilled florists handcraft each arrangement with care, ensuring a full, neat finish and beautiful colour contrast. Approximate dimensions are 58cm (23") in height and 55cm (22") in width, making it a striking yet tasteful display beside the coffin or at the service.

At Flowers Kilburn, we use only high-quality, fresh flowers. Due to seasonal availability, we may substitute certain blooms with similar flowers of equal or superior style, colour and value. We recommend sending funeral tributes directly to the Funeral Director to avoid any additional distress for the family and to ensure timely placement at the service.
